Description
Improper Control of Generation of Code ('Code Injection') vulnerability in Jordy Meow Code Engine allows Remote Code Inclusion. This issue affects Code Engine: from n/a through 0.3.3.
EPSS Score:
0%
Comprehensive Technical Analysis of EUVD-2025-25336
1. Vulnerability Assessment and Severity Evaluation
The vulnerability EUVD-2025-25336, also known as CVE-2025-48169, is classified as an "Improper Control of Generation of Code ('Code Injection')" issue in the Jordy Meow Code Engine. This vulnerability allows for Remote Code Inclusion, which is a severe form of Remote Code Execution (RCE). The CVSS (Common Vulnerability Scoring System) base score of 9.9 indicates a critical severity level. The CVSS vector C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H breaks down as follows:
- Attack Vector (AV): Network (N) - The vulnerability is exploitable over the network.
- Attack Complexity (AC): Low (L) - The attack requires minimal skill or resources.
- Privileges Required (PR): Low (L) - The attacker needs low-level privileges to exploit the vulnerability.
- User Interaction (UI): None (N) - No user interaction is required for the attack to succeed.
- Scope (S): Changed (C) - The vulnerability affects a different security scope.
- Confidentiality (C): High (H) - The vulnerability results in a high impact on confidentiality.
- Integrity (I): High (H) - The vulnerability results in a high impact on integrity.
- Availability (A): High (H) - The vulnerability results in a high impact on availability.
2. Potential Attack Vectors and Exploitation Methods
The primary attack vector for this vulnerability is through network-based exploitation. An attacker could inject malicious code into the Jordy Meow Code Engine, leading to Remote Code Inclusion. This could be achieved by:
- Exploiting Input Validation Flaws: The attacker could send specially crafted input to the application, bypassing input validation mechanisms.
- Manipulating Code Generation: The attacker could manipulate the code generation process to include malicious code, which would then be executed by the application.
- Using Automated Tools: Attackers might use automated tools to scan for and exploit this vulnerability, especially given the low attack complexity.
3. Affected Systems and Software Versions
The vulnerability affects the Jordy Meow Code Engine from version n/a through 0.3.3. This means that all versions up to and including 0.3.3 are vulnerable. Organizations using these versions should prioritize updating or patching their systems.
4. Recommended Mitigation Strategies
To mitigate the risk associated with this vulnerability, the following strategies are recommended:
- Immediate Patching: Apply the latest patches or updates provided by Jordy Meow. Ensure that the Code Engine is updated to a version higher than 0.3.3.
- Input Validation: Implement robust input validation mechanisms to prevent malicious code injection.
- Code Review: Conduct thorough code reviews to identify and fix any code generation flaws.
- Network Security: Implement network security measures such as firewalls and intrusion detection systems to monitor and block suspicious network activity.
- Access Control: Enforce strict access controls to limit the privileges required to exploit the vulnerability.
- Regular Audits: Conduct regular security audits and vulnerability assessments to identify and address potential security issues.
5. Impact on European Cybersecurity Landscape
The critical nature of this vulnerability poses a significant risk to the European cybersecurity landscape. Organizations and individuals using the affected software versions are at high risk of data breaches, unauthorized access, and system compromise. The widespread use of the Jordy Meow Code Engine in various applications and services amplifies the potential impact. European cybersecurity authorities should issue advisories and guidelines to ensure that organizations are aware of the vulnerability and take appropriate mitigation steps.
6. Technical Details for Security Professionals
For security professionals, the following technical details are essential:
- Detection: Use security tools and scripts to detect the presence of the vulnerability in the affected systems. Look for anomalies in code generation processes and unusual network traffic patterns.
- Exploitation: Understand the exploitation methods, such as crafting malicious input to bypass validation and inject code. This knowledge is crucial for developing effective defenses.
- Patch Management: Ensure that patch management processes are in place to quickly apply updates and patches. Regularly monitor vendor announcements for new patches.
- Incident Response: Develop an incident response plan that includes steps for identifying, containing, and remediating the vulnerability. Ensure that the plan includes communication protocols for notifying stakeholders and regulatory bodies.
- Continuous Monitoring: Implement continuous monitoring solutions to detect and respond to any attempts to exploit the vulnerability. Use logs and alerts to track suspicious activities.
By addressing these points, organizations can effectively manage the risk associated with EUVD-2025-25336 and protect their systems from potential attacks.